Dublin vs Hao Climate & Distance Between

French Polynesia flag
  • The distance between Dublin, Ireland and Hao, French Polynesia is approximately 14,495 km or 9,007 mi.
  • To reach Dublin in this distance one would set out from Hao bearing 33.8°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Dublin bearing 117.6° or ESE .
  • Dublin has a marine west coast climate (Cfb) whereas Hao has a tropical rainforest climate (Af).
  • The mean annual temperature is 16.7 °C (30.1°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 7.2 °C (13°F) more in Dublin.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to extremely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 730.8 mm (28.8 in) less which is equivalent to 730.8 l/m² (17.94 US gal/ft²) or 7,308,000 l/ha (781,274 US gal/ac) less. About 1/2 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 32.7° lower in Dublin than in Hao.
